The City of Santa Ana is celebrating Native American Heritage Month at Thornton Park on Nov. 12 from 11 a.m. to 5 p.m. Thornton Park is located at 1801 West Segerstrom Avenue.

This family-friendly festival will celebrate the the rich diverse cultures and traditions of the Native American and Indigenous communities with music, crafts, traditional song and dance, storytelling, and interactive experiences.

Attendees can also look forward to special performances from world champion hoop dancer, Eric Hernandez. Additional event information can be found here.

This is coordinated and brought to the community by All Occasions Services, a full-service event production & management company selected by the City of Santa Ana through a Request for Proposal (RFP) process. Upon considering all proposals, the City selected All Occasions Services to produce the 2023 event.
